Implementing a quality gate is essential in determining if a particular group of metadata meets specific deployment requirements. A quality gate function as a set of criteria or conditions that must be met before the metadata can progress through the deployment pipeline. This might involve checks for coding standards, compliance with best practices, or the passing of automated tests. Quality gates help ensure consistency, reliability, and adherence to outlined standards within the deployment process.

While manual checks, automation checks, and running associated tests can all contribute to validating metadata, they do not provide the structured framework that quality gates offer. Quality gates consolidate various checks into a systematic approach to ensure comprehensive evaluation against the defined requirements, making them critical in the context of a disciplined deployment process.
